Strongylodon macrobotrysDistribution
This plant exhibits a diverse geographical range that spans across several distinct tropical regions. Within the Indian Subcontinent, it can be found growing in India. Its distribution continues through Malesia, where it is located in both Malaya and the Philippines. In the Papuasia region, the species is present in New Guinea. Finally, its reach extends to the Caribbean, specifically within Trinidad and Tobago.

Ecology
The ecology of Strongylodon macrobotrys is defined by its preference for high-altitude tropical environments, specifically thriving within a specialized montane niche. This species is predominantly found occupying an elevational range that begins at 1200 m AMSL and extends up to a maximum of 1500 m AMSL. Within this vertical corridor, the plant relies on the unique microclimates provided by mid-to-high elevation cloud forests, where humidity levels and temperature fluctuations are stabilized by frequent mist and moisture-laden air. Its survival and reproductive success are closely tied to these specific altitudinal belts, which dictate the availability of specialized pollinators and the structural support required for its climbing growth habit.

Morphology
The morphology of Strongylodon macrobotrys is characterized by its growth habit as a woody liana, exhibiting variable woodiness throughout its development. As an obligatory climber, it relies on structural support to ascend through forest canopies rather than being self-supporting. The plant is strictly terrestrial in its ecological niche, functioning as an independent organism that does not exhibit parasitic behavior, nor does it grow as an epiphyte, remaining firmly rooted in the soil. Unlike aquatic or semiaquatic species, its physiological structure is adapted entirely to terrestrial environments.
